Лейблы в Delphi — удобный способ отображения текста на форме приложения. Однако, иногда возникает необходимость очистить лейбл от текущего содержимого и установить новое значение. К счастью, Delphi предоставляет несколько эффективных способов для решения этой задачи.
Первым способом очистки лейбла является простое присвоение пустого значения свойству Text. Например, чтобы очистить лейбл с именем Label1, можно использовать следующий код:
Label1.Text := '';
Этот код просто устанавливает пустое значение в свойство Text лейбла. После выполнения этой строки, лейбл будет отображаться без текста.
Вторым способом очистки лейбла является использование специального метода Clear. Метод Clear устанавливает не только пустое значение в свойство Text, но также сбрасывает другие свойства лейбла, такие как цвет и шрифт. Пример использования метода Clear:
Label1.Clear;
Третий способ очистки лейбла — использование свойства Caption вместо свойства Text. В Delphi свойство Caption является синонимом свойства Text, поэтому следующий код также очистит лейбл:
Label1.Caption := '';
Независимо от выбранного способа, эти методы позволяют легко и эффективно очистить лейбл в Delphi. Они могут быть использованы в различных ситуациях, когда необходимо обновить отображаемый текст в лейбле.
Учтите, что для использования этих методов необходимо иметь ссылку на объект лейбла в коде вашего приложения.
Очистка лейбла в Delphi: эффективные способы удалить текст из компонента
Иногда может возникнуть необходимость очистить лейбл от текста. Это может быть полезно, например, при обновлении информации или после выполнения определенного действия в приложении. Существуют несколько эффективных способов удаления текста из компонента «лейбл» в Delphi.
Первый способ — использование свойства «Caption» компонента. Для очистки лейбла достаточно присвоить свойству «Caption» пустое значение:
Label1.Caption := '';
Второй способ — использование метода «SetText» компонента. Метод «SetText» позволяет задать текст для лейбла. Чтобы удалить текст, необходимо вызвать этот метод со значением пустой строки:
Label1.SetText('');
Третий способ — использование функции «SetWindowText» из модуля «Windows». Функция «SetWindowText» позволяет установить текст для компонента, используя его дескриптор. Чтобы очистить лейбл, необходимо вызвать эту функцию со значением пустой строки:
SetWindowText(Label1.Handle, PChar(''));
Четвертый способ — использование свойства «Text» компонента. Для удаления текста из лейбла достаточно присвоить свойству «Text» пустое значение:
Label1.Text := '';
Очистка лейбла в Delphi — это простая и быстрая операция, которую можно выполнить с помощью различных способов. Выбор способа зависит от требуемой функциональности и контекста использования. Используйте описанные выше методы для успешной очистки лейбла в Delphi.
Удаление текста из лейбла с помощью свойства Text
Чтобы удалить текст из лейбла с помощью свойства Text, достаточно установить значение свойства в пустую строку. Для этого можно использовать следующий код:
Label1.Text := '';
Этот код обращается к объекту Label1 (где Label1 — имя вашего лейбла) и устанавливает свойство Text в пустую строку, тем самым очищая его содержимое.
Если лейбл содержит текст, то после выполнения указанного выше кода текст будет удален и лейбл станет пустым. Если же лейбл изначально уже был пустым, то выполнение кода не приведет к каким-либо изменениям.
Таким образом, использование свойства Text является простым и эффективным способом удаления текста из лейбла в Delphi.
Использование метода Caption для очистки лейбла в Delphi
Очистка лейбла в Delphi может быть выполнена с использованием метода Caption. Метод Caption позволяет установить текст, который будет отображаться внутри лейбла.
Для очистки лейбла, достаточно установить пустую строку в качестве значения параметра Caption. Например, чтобы очистить лейбл с именем Label1, можно использовать следующий код:
Label1.Caption := '';
Этот код устанавливает пустую строку в качестве значения параметра Caption для лейбла Label1, что приводит к его очистке.
Метод Caption также может быть использован для установки нового значения текста лейбла. Например, чтобы установить текст «Привет, мир!» в лейбл Label1, можно использовать следующий код:
Label1.Caption := 'Привет, мир!';
Теперь лейбл Label1 будет отображать текст «Привет, мир!».
Используя метод Caption для очистки лейбла в Delphi, вы можете эффективно управлять отображаемым текстом и обновлять его при необходимости. Убедитесь, что вы правильно указываете имя лейбла и используете метод Caption в нужном месте вашего кода.
Удаление текста из компонента TLabel с помощью метода Clear
Очистка текста из компонента TLabel в Delphi может быть выполнена с помощью метода Clear. Этот метод позволяет удалить все содержимое лейбла и сделать его пустым.
Для удаления текста из компонента TLabel с помощью метода Clear необходимо выполнить следующие шаги:
- Убедитесь, что компонент TLabel находится на форме вашего проекта.
- Воспользуйтесь объектом TLabel, к которому вы хотите применить метод Clear.
- Вызовите метод Clear для данного объекта, например:
Label1.Clear;
После выполнения указанных шагов текст в компоненте TLabel будет полностью удален и лейбл станет пустым.
Использование метода Clear является простым и эффективным способом удаления текста из компонента TLabel в Delphi. Он особенно полезен, когда вы хотите очистить лейбл, прежде чем в него будет записан новый текст.